What Gets Calibrated on the LINCOLN ELECTRIC POWERWAVE S500

During the calibration of the Lincoln Electric POWERWAVE S500, we verify several critical parameters, including output voltage, current, and weld time accuracy. This calibration process ensures the welder operates within specified limits, enhancing the quality of welds produced. Standards applicable to this calibration include ISO/IEC 17025, among others.

Why Calibration Matters for the LINCOLN ELECTRIC POWERWAVE S500

Over time, components within the Lincoln Electric POWERWAVE S500 can experience drift and degradation, particularly in settings where the unit is exposed to high heat and electrical loads. Uncalibrated machines may deliver inconsistent arc stability and weld quality, leading to potential structural failures in welded materials.

Ensuring the repeatability of welds and maintaining organizational control are vital, especially in industries such as automotive manufacturing and aerospace. Regular calibration instills confidence in the welding processes and aligns production with quality standards such as ISO 9001 and AS9100.
